Prologue

For many months, Nina has been a hunted assassin. Day by day, she was, stalked, chased and constantly shot at by relentless hit men.

She had no clue as to why these ruthless assassins were after her or who sent them after her in the first place. One thing she did know was she wasn't going to be their victim.

Strangely enough, they had been chasing her ever since the syndicate she once worked for had fallen, thanks to a certain police detective. No matter how persistent these hit men were, they were no match for the blonde assassin that was Nina Williams.

Any hit man that dared to take Williams on would end up dead lying in a gutter somewhere.


A few days later

Nina happened to be sitting at a local diner having one of her favorite meals when a familiar face suddenly walked in. He calmly sat down right next to her and ordered up a quick breakfast to start the day.

He brushed his long golden blonde hair back away from his face as he waited patiently for his meal to arrive. Nina glanced over at his face and slightly jumped back a little in her chair from surprise in a startled manner.

The man sitting next to her was Steve Fox, the very man the syndicate had sent her to kill a while ago. After the syndicate had fallen, Nina no longer had a purpose to kill Steve.

The main thing bothering Nina was back when she once worked for the syndicate, they had informed her that Steve Fox was her own son. When she heard the news, she felt nothing from it and acted like it was no big deal.

Steve being in the diner caught her completely off guard, as she was expecting not to ever see him again. After seeing her son for the second time, Nina turns the other way around in her chair and goes back to eating her meal uncaringly.

Steve slowly turns his head towards Nina as her constant loud chomping was getting on his nerves. He had kindly asked her to stop but she refused and continued.

"Excuse me, do you think you could chew a little softer?" he politely asked.

"Humph!" snorted Nina.

Steve took one look at her face and began to feel like he had seen her somewhere before. Looking back at her hair, eyes, he knew he surely recognized her from somewhere.

"Excuse me, but have we met?" he said asking Nina.

Nina let out a quiet cold "no" and went back to her eating. Every time Steve asked her, she attempted to dodge the questions by giving him smart mouthed rude replies. After awhile, Steve saw his questions going nowhere and immediately decided to stop.

Soon, Nina finished her meal and wiped the tiny crumbs of food from her face. After paying up, she was on her way outside.

Unexpectedly, a few round of bullets began pouring through the window directly at her. The glass from the window quickly shattered and fell to the floor scattering everywhere.

Luckily, the bullets missed their designated target and ended up hitting a nearby wall. Everyone in the diner started screaming in panic, running outside to avoid being shot.

The only people left in the diner were Steve and Nina. Nina had pulled a gun out from her coat pocket and aimed it up high to shoot the assassin firing from outside. But curtains that stood in the way of her fire obstructed her view.

The Assassin outside fired off another round of bullets, but they weren't coming towards Nina. Instead she saw one of the bullets heading towards Steve's chest.

Her eyes darted over towards her son as she rolled up from the floor and jumped in the bullets path to prevent it from hitting Steve. Within the next second, the bullet went straight into Nina's leg as she crashed back onto the floor.

Steve Fox couldn't believe what had just happened, a woman had just saved his life. Before another shot could be fired from outside, Nina grabbed her gun from the floor and shot the assassin dead.

Realizing she had killed him, Nina threw her gun to the floor and passed out. The last thing she heard was a loud screaming siren of an incoming ambulance.
